The Role of Office Divider Partitions in Enhancing Privacy

Open-plan offices were once hailed as the future of work, encouraging collaboration and interaction. However, they often come at the cost of personal space and focus. This is where office divider partitions prove invaluable. They allow employees to work in a distraction-free environment without the need for permanent walls. By creating visual and acoustic barriers, partitions offer a sense of privacy while maintaining openness in the broader office layout.

These partitions are especially useful in settings where employees handle sensitive information or require quiet zones for focused tasks. With the rise of hybrid work models, the demand for semi-private spaces within shared environments has skyrocketed. Partitions make it easy to allocate quiet zones, meeting areas, and collaborative hubs without undertaking costly renovations. Moreover, mobile divider panels provide the added advantage of flexibility, enabling teams to reconfigure spaces based on changing needs.

Creative Design Options and Aesthetic Appeal

Gone are the days when office divider partitions were merely dull panels placed to separate desks. Todays designs emphasize creativity, branding, and visual coherence. Available in materials such as frosted glass, fabric, acrylic, wood, and metal, partitions can be customized to reflect the companys culture and interior themes. Incorporating colors, logos, and textures helps create a unified aesthetic that resonates with employees and clients alike.

In addition to boosting aesthetics, office partitions also contribute to a clean and organized environment. Many partitions come with built-in shelves, whiteboards, or planters, merging utility with design. For instance, a partition with greenery not only divides the space but also promotes better air quality and a calming ambiance. This integration of function and form is a key trend in modern office interiors, helping businesses make a lasting impression.

Cost-Effective Solutions for Office Layout Transformation

Compared to traditional construction, using office divider partitions is a significantly more affordable way to transform your office space. Renovations involving drywall or glass walls can be time-consuming, costly, and permanent. Partitions, on the other hand, offer a lower upfront cost and quicker installation, with minimal disruption to daily operations. This makes them particularly attractive to small and medium enterprises (SMEs) that want to create dynamic workspaces without breaking the bank.

Even larger corporations benefit from the cost-effectiveness of partitions. With ongoing changes in team structures, project scopes, and workforce size, being able to reconfigure the office layout without additional construction costs is invaluable. Some partitions are even designed to be DIY-friendly, allowing in-house teams to manage setup and changes, reducing reliance on external contractors.

Sustainability and Eco-Friendly Options

Sustainability is becoming a major consideration in office design, and many manufacturers now offer eco-friendly office divider partition options. These include partitions made from recycled materials, biodegradable fabrics, or sustainably sourced wood. Choosing green products not only supports the environment but also enhances your brands corporate responsibility.

Additionally, many partitions are designed to be reused or repurposed, minimizing waste. Modular designs mean that businesses can retain and repurpose panels for future projects or office moves. These sustainable choices align with global trends toward responsible consumption and can also contribute to green building certifications like LEED.
